#298ded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#298ded is composed of 16.1% red, 55.3% green and 92.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 82.7% cyan, 40.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 7.1% black. It has a hue angle of 209.4 degrees, a saturation of 84.5% and a lightness of 54.5%. #298ded color hex could be obtained by blending #52ffff with #001bdb. Closest websafe color is: #3399ff.

Shades and Tints of #298ded

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000203 is the darkest color, while #f0f7fe is the lightest one.

Tones of #298ded

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#828b94 is the less saturated color, while #178dff is the most saturated one.
